A microfluidic microbial culture device for rapid determination of the minimum inhibitory concentration of antibiotics
Rika Takagi,Junji Fukuda,Keiji Nagata,Yutaka Yawata,Nobuhiko Nomura,Hiroaki Suzuki
Analyst Pub Date : 12/18/2012 00:00:00 , DOI:10.1039/C2AN36323B
Abstract

A microfluidic device was developed for rapid determination of the minimum inhibitory concentration (MIC) of antibiotics against bacteria. A small volume of sample solution was introduced into multiple chambers simultaneously, and the growth of bacteria was quantified using a noninvasive three-dimensional (3D) visualization technique.
